Transaction 1091b24de9998525ced9f1452605ff89da068b3ced27f768ac7bd790a8432dab
1 Input
1 Output
-
1091b24de9998525ced9f1452605ff89da068b3ced27f768ac7bd790a8432dab:0
- value
- 76052120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c560d93f56d7ab6c967a9e16ee83a87002efd084 OP_EQUAL
- address
- 3Kgf4VeAhzYENaeRKmF4X5nBXcGKN4TndR